How they compare

Guatemala currently reports 0.4475 t per square kilometre against 0.3085 t per square kilometre in Philippines, a difference of 0.139 t per square kilometre.

That makes Guatemala's figure about 1.5 times Philippines's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 58 shared years of data; in 1966 it was Guatemala ahead.

Guatemala ranks 42nd and Philippines ranks 45th of 166 countries.

Philippines has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Guatemala Philippines Difference Ahead
1960s 0.0583 t per square kilometre 0.0639 t per square kilometre 0.0055 t per square kilometre Philippines
1970s 0.109 t per square kilometre 0.1647 t per square kilometre 0.0557 t per square kilometre Philippines
1980s 0.0999 t per square kilometre 0.1651 t per square kilometre 0.0652 t per square kilometre Philippines
1990s 0.0262 t per square kilometre 0.2307 t per square kilometre 0.2046 t per square kilometre Philippines
2000s 0.0158 t per square kilometre 0.2246 t per square kilometre 0.2088 t per square kilometre Philippines
2010s 0.0805 t per square kilometre 0.2417 t per square kilometre 0.1612 t per square kilometre Philippines
2020s 0.2286 t per square kilometre 0.3082 t per square kilometre 0.0796 t per square kilometre Philippines

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
